1-8 out of 8
Sort by:
high popularity
- Price: low to high
- Price: high to low
- Guest rating: high to low
- Popularity: high to low
8.1
Great1112 total reviews
our site & Booking.com
Map
6.9 km from City Centre
Featuring aerobics classes and entertainment activities, the 4-star Runnymede On Thames Egham is located in a business neighbourhood.
From£ 180
/nightSelect
Castle Hotel WindsorHotel
8.3
Great1824 total reviews
our site & Booking.com
The Castle Hotel is based about a 5-minute walk from Windsor Castle in Windsor, and consists of 100 rooms with standard decor.
From£ 133
/nightSelect


8.4
Great1787 total reviews
our site & Booking.com
Map
700 m from City Centre200 m from Windsor & Eton Riverside Railway Station
Featuring 56 rooms, spa therapy and entertainment activities, the 4-star Sir Christopher Wren is a 10-minute ride from LEGOLAND Windsor Resort in Windsor.
From£ 107
/nightSelect


Oakley CourtHotel
8.6
Great136 total reviews
our site & Booking.com
Map
4.3 km from City Centre600 m from Dorney Lake
Windsor Castle is within a 10-minute drive of the 4-star Oakley Court.
From£ 209
/nightSelect


9.0
Perfect862 total reviews
our site & Booking.com
Map
7.4 km from City Centre
Featuring 12 rooms with views of the garden, the 4-star Winning Post Windsor is set about 30 km from London Heathrow airport.
From£ 127
/nightSelect


Macdonald WindsorHotel
8.6
Great4118 total reviews
our site & Booking.com
Map
500 m from City Centre200 m from Windsor & Eton Central Railway Station
Located in a historic building, the perfect Macdonald is a perfect place to stay within 18 minutes' walk of Irish Guardsman Statue, and not far from a train station.
From£ 131
/nightSelect


9.1
Perfect3149 total reviews
our site & Booking.com
Map
1000 m from City Centre400 m from Windsor & Eton Riverside Railway Station
Situated near a train station, the contemporary 3-star Christopher Hotel, Eton is about 6 minutes' walk from St George's Chapel.
From£ 115
/nightSelect


8.0
Great734 total reviews
our site & Booking.com
Map
800 m from City Centre200 m from Windsor & Eton Riverside Railway Station
Situated only 0.6 km from Windsor Castle, the 3-star George Inn features 9 rooms with private bathrooms.
From£ 83
/nightSelect
Windsor hotels
| 🏨 Romantic hotels in Windsor | 8 |
| 👛 Lowest price | 133 GBP |